Understanding Fat Loss
To start, it is essential to comprehend what fat loss truly means. At its core, fat loss occurs when we expend more calories than we consume. This energy deficit can be achieved through a combination of an effective workout regimen and smart dietary choices. While we might think of this as a straightforward equation, the intricacies of our bodies and the ways we respond to different types of exercise can alter the dynamics substantially.
Incorporating resistance training, cardiovascular activities, and metabolic conditioning into our routines can foster a more dynamic approach to fat loss. By understanding how our bodies respond to these activities, we can optimize our efforts and see tangible results.
The Science Behind High-Impact Workouts
High-impact workouts are characterized by dynamic movements that elevate our heart rate dramatically. This elevated heart rate results in higher calorie expenditure both during our workouts and after—in a phenomenon commonly referred to as excess post-exercise oxygen consumption (EPOC). Essentially, our bodies continue to burn calories post-workout as they recover from high-intensity exercises, making these routines particularly effective for fat loss.
Research suggests that high-impact workouts, which may include plyometric exercises, interval training, and compound movements, can ignite both metabolic and muscular improvements. These workouts can also enhance our cardiovascular health and increase muscle mass, further supporting our fat loss goals.

High-Impact Moves for Fat Loss
We have identified various high-impact exercises that can serve as cornerstones for our fat loss workouts. Below, we will highlight several essential movements that we can integrate into our gym routines.
1. Jump Squats
Jump squats are an excellent plyometric exercise that combines strength training with explosive movements.
-
How to Perform: Stand with feet shoulder-width apart. Lower our body into a squat, keeping our chest up and back straight. From the squat position, engage our core and explode upwards, jumping as high as we can. Land softly back into the squat position and proceed to the next rep.
-
Benefits: Jump squats work multiple muscle groups, including quadriceps, hamstrings, and glutes. This exercise can significantly elevate our heart rate while building strength.
2. Burpees
Burpees are a full-body exercise that challenges our cardiovascular system while also providing strength training benefits.
-
How to Perform: Start in a standing position. Drop into a squat with our hands on the ground, kick our feet back into a plank position, perform a push-up if desired, jump our feet back toward our hands, and explode upwards into a jump. Repeat for desired reps.
-
Benefits: This high-intensity movement engages our arms, core, and legs effectively, leading to maximum calorie burn. Burpees are also highly efficient, offering both strength and cardiovascular conditioning.
3. Kettlebell Swings
Kettlebell swings are a fantastic compound movement that targets our posterior chain, engaging muscles in our back, glutes, and legs.
-
How to Perform: Stand with feet slightly wider than shoulder-width apart. Hold the kettlebell with both hands in front of us and slightly bend our knees. Swing the kettlebell back between our legs, then thrust our hips forward, swinging the kettlebell to shoulder height. Control the descent back to the starting position.
-
Benefits: Kettlebell swings boost our heart rate and help improve hip and core strength, leading to effective fat loss when combined with a cohesive workout routine.
4. Box Jumps
Box jumps are another plyometric exercise that we can use to develop explosiveness while improving our cardiovascular fitness.
-
How to Perform: Stand in front of a sturdy box or platform. Bend our knees slightly and swing our arms back, then leap onto the box, landing softly. Step back down and repeat.
-
Benefits: This exercise helps build lower-body strength while delivering an outstanding cardiovascular workout, leading to higher calorie burning.
5. Battle Ropes
Battle ropes involve rhythmic movements that engage our entire body while elevating our heart rate quickly.
-
How to Perform: Anchor the battle ropes at the base. Hold one end of the rope in each hand and alternate raising and lowering our arms to create waves in the ropes while maintaining a slight squat and core engagement.
-
Benefits: Battle ropes not only improve cardiovascular fitness but also build upper-body strength, enhancing our overall fitness levels.
Structuring Our High-Impact Workout Routine
To tailor an effective workout strategy for fat loss, we will structure our high-impact sessions to include a mixture of exercises targeting both strength and endurance. Below, we offer a framework for a typical 45-minute gym session designed to maximize calorie burn.
Warm-Up (5-10 Minutes)
A dynamic warm-up is vital to prepare our bodies for high-impact activities. We can include moves such as:
- High knees
- Arm circles
- Leg swings
- Light jogging or skipping
Workout Circuit (30 Minutes)
Incorporating the exercises we discussed, we can structure our workout into circuits for maximum efficiency. A sample circuit might include the following:
| Exercise | Duration/Reps |
|---|---|
| Jump Squats | 30 seconds |
| Burpees | 30 seconds |
| Kettlebell Swings | 30 seconds |
| Box Jumps | 30 seconds |
| Rest | 1 minute |
Repeat the circuit 3-4 times based on our fitness level, gradually increasing durations or the number of circuits as our stamina improves.
Cool Down (5-10 Minutes)
A proper cool-down period is essential to lower our heart rate gradually and enhance recovery. We can include static stretches focusing on the major muscle groups used during our workout.

Fine-Tuning Our Nutrition
Achieving fat loss also significantly relies on our dietary choices. Fueling our bodies with nutritious, whole foods enhances our performance in high-impact workouts and supports recovery. Key nutritional elements we should consider include:
-
Protein: Incorporating lean proteins can aid in muscle repair and growth, supporting our metabolism. Foods such as chicken, fish, lentils, and legumes play an essential role.
-
Complex Carbohydrates: Whole grains, fruits, and vegetables provide energy to fuel our workouts, allowing us to tackle high-intensity moves effectively.
-
Healthy Fats: Avocado, nuts, seeds, and olive oil contribute beneficial fats that promote satiety and nutrient absorption.
-
Hydration: Staying hydrated is vital for optimal performance and recovery. Water should remain our beverage of choice, complemented by electrolytes as necessary post-exercise.
